Delaying Medical Attention

One of the biggest mistakes you can make is waiting to seek medical care after an accident. Even if you don’t feel severely injured, it's vital to get checked by a medical professional immediately. Delays in treatment risk your health and weaken your claim, as insurance companies may argue that your injuries are not as serious as you claim or that they were caused by something other than the accident.


Not Documenting the Accident Thoroughly

Failing to gather evidence can significantly harm your case. Take photos of the accident scene, your injuries, and any property damage. Collect contact information from witnesses and keep records of all related expenses, such as medical bills and repair costs. Proper documentation strengthens your claim and provides tangible proof of your damages.


Speaking to Insurance Adjusters Without Legal Counsel

Insurance adjusters may seem friendly, but their goal is to minimize the payout. Speaking to them without the guidance of an attorney can lead to missteps, such as admitting fault or downplaying your injuries. It's best to let your attorney handle all communications with the insurance company to avoid inadvertently harming your case.


Accepting the First Settlement Offer

Insurance companies often offer a quick settlement to close the case early. However, these initial offers are usually much lower than what you deserve. Accepting the first offer without consulting your attorney could result in receiving far less compensation than you need to cover your medical expenses, lost wages, and other damages.
